Orange County is a county situated in Southern California, U.S.A. With a existing estimated population of three million, it has the second most individuals for any county in the state of California, and has the fifth most men and women for any county in all of the Unites States. Known for its wealth and political conservatism, the county, in actual reality is neither as consistently wealthy or as politically conservative as the stereotypical image it has gained suggests. Popular for tourism, Orange County is house to Disneyland as properly as miles upon miles of sandy beaches. Orange County is situated correct at the center of Southern California's Tech Coast.

Despite its huge population, Orange County has a total location of two,455 km which makes it the smallest county in all of Southern California. The county is bordered on the north by Los Angeles County, on the west by the Pacific Ocean, on the east by Riverside County, on the northeast by San Bernardino County, and on the south by San Diego County. The most northern injury lawyer in orange county part of the county sits on the coastal plains of the Los Angeles Basin. The southern half sits on the foothills of the Santa Ana Mountains.

The majority of the population of Orange County reside in one of two shallow coastal valleys that are in the basin. These two shallow coastal basins are: the Santa Ana Valley and the Saddleback Valley.

The cities in Orange County are connected by a network of freeways. Residents of Orange County normally contact these freeways by their route number rather than their formal name.
